Psalms 41

1 Blessed is he who considers the [a] poor; The Lord will deliver him in time of trouble. 365N 142.1

2 The Lord will preserve him and keep him alive, And he will be blessed on the earth; You will not deliver him to the will of his enemies. 365N 142.2

3 The Lord will strengthen him on his bed of illness; You will [b] sustain him on his sickbed. 365N 142.3

4 I said, “ Lord , be merciful to me; Heal my soul, for I have sinned against You.” 365N 142.4

5 My enemies speak evil of me: “When will he die, and his name perish?” 365N 142.5

6 And if he comes to see me, he speaks [c] lies; His heart gathers iniquity to itself; When he goes out, he tells it. 365N 142.6

7 All who hate me whisper together against me; Against me they [d] devise my hurt. 365N 142.7

8 “An [e] evil disease,” they say, “clings to him. And now that he lies down, he will rise up no more.” 365N 142.8

9 Even my own familiar friend in whom I trusted, Who ate my bread, Has [f] lifted up his heel against me. 365N 142.9

10 But You, O Lord , be merciful to me, and raise me up, That I may repay them. 365N 142.10

11 By this I know that You are well pleased with me, Because my enemy does not triumph over me. 365N 142.11

12 As for me, You uphold me in my integrity, And set me before Your face forever. 365N 142.12

13 Blessed be the Lord God of Israel From everlasting to everlasting! Amen and Amen. 365N 142.13

Psalms 42

1 As the deer [b] pants for the water brooks, So pants my soul for You, O God. 365N 142.14

2 My soul thirsts for God, for the living God. When shall I come and [c] appear before God? 365N 142.15

3 My tears have been my food day and night, While they continually say to me, “Where is your God?” 365N 142.16

4 When I remember these things, I pour out my soul within me. For I used to go with the multitude; I went with them to the house of God, With the voice of joy and praise, With a multitude that kept a pilgrim feast. 365N 142.17

5 Why are you [d] cast down, O my soul? And why are you disquieted within me? Hope in God, for I shall yet praise Him [e] For the help of His countenance. 365N 142.18

6 [f] O my God, my soul is cast down within me; Therefore I will remember You from the land of the Jordan, And from the heights of Hermon, From [g] the Hill Mizar. 365N 142.19

7 Deep calls unto deep at the noise of Your waterfalls; All Your waves and billows have gone over me. 365N 142.20

8 The Lord will command His lovingkindness in the daytime, And in the night His song shall be with me— A prayer to the God of my life. 365N 142.21

9 I will say to God my Rock, “Why have You forgotten me? Why do I go mourning because of the oppression of the enemy?” 365N 142.22

10 As with a [h] breaking of my bones, My enemies [i] reproach me, While they say to me all day long, “Where is your God?” 365N 142.23

11 Why are you cast down, O my soul? And why are you disquieted within me? Hope in God; For I shall yet praise Him, The [j] help of my countenance and my God. 365N 142.24

Psalms 43

1 Vindicate me, O God, And plead my cause against an ungodly nation; Oh, deliver me from the deceitful and unjust man! 365N 142.25

2 For You are the God of my strength; Why do You cast me off? Why do I go mourning because of the oppression of the enemy? 365N 142.26

3 Oh, send out Your light and Your truth! Let them lead me; Let them bring me to Your holy hill And to Your [a] tabernacle. 365N 142.27

4 Then I will go to the altar of God, To God my exceeding joy; And on the harp I will praise You, O God, my God. 365N 142.28

5 Why are you cast down, O my soul? And why are you disquieted within me? Hope in God; For I shall yet praise Him, The [b] help of my countenance and my God. 365N 142.29

Psalms 44

1 We have heard with our ears, O God, Our fathers have told us, The deeds You did in their days, In days of old: 365N 142.30

2 You drove out the [b] nations with Your hand, But them You planted; You afflicted the peoples, and cast them out. 365N 142.31

3 For they did not gain possession of the land by their own sword, Nor did their own arm save them; But it was Your right hand, Your arm, and the light of Your countenance, Because You favored them. 365N 142.32

4 You are my King, [c] O God; [d] Command victories for Jacob. 365N 142.33

5 Through You we will push down our enemies; Through Your name we will trample those who rise up against us. 365N 142.34

6 For I will not trust in my bow, Nor shall my sword save me. 365N 142.35

7 But You have saved us from our enemies, And have put to shame those who hated us. 365N 142.36

8 In God we boast all day long, And praise Your name forever. Selah 365N 142.37

9 But You have cast us off and put us to shame, And You do not go out with our armies. 365N 142.38

10 You make us turn back from the enemy, And those who hate us have taken [e] spoil for themselves. 365N 142.39

11 You have given us up like sheep intended for food, And have scattered us among the nations. 365N 142.40

12 You sell Your people for next to nothing, And are not enriched by selling them. 365N 142.41

13 You make us a reproach to our neighbors, A scorn and a derision to those all around us. 365N 142.42

14 You make us a byword among the nations, A shaking of the head among the peoples. 365N 142.43

15 My dishonor is continually before me, And the shame of my face has covered me, 365N 142.44

16 Because of the voice of him who reproaches and reviles, Because of the enemy and the avenger. 365N 142.45

17 All this has come upon us; But we have not forgotten You, Nor have we dealt falsely with Your covenant. 365N 142.46

18 Our heart has not turned back, Nor have our steps departed from Your way; 365N 142.47

19 But You have severely broken us in the place of jackals, And covered us with the shadow of death. 365N 142.48

20 If we had forgotten the name of our God, Or stretched [f] out our hands to a foreign god, 365N 142.49

21 Would not God search this out? For He knows the secrets of the heart. 365N 142.50

22 Yet for Your sake we are killed all day long; We are accounted as sheep for the slaughter. 365N 142.51

23 Awake! Why do You sleep, O Lord? Arise! Do not cast us off forever. 365N 142.52

24 Why do You hide Your face, And forget our affliction and our oppression? 365N 142.53

25 For our soul is bowed down to the [g] dust; Our body clings to the ground. 365N 142.54

26 Arise for our help, And redeem us for Your mercies’ sake. 365N 142.55

Psalms 45

1 My heart is overflowing with a good theme; I recite my composition concerning the King; My tongue is the pen of a [c] ready writer. 365N 142.56

2 You are fairer than the sons of men; Grace is poured upon Your lips; Therefore God has blessed You forever. 365N 142.57

3 [d] Gird Your sword upon Your thigh, O Mighty One, With Your glory and Your majesty. 365N 142.58

4 And in Your majesty ride prosperously because of truth, humility, and righteousness; And Your right hand shall teach You awesome things. 365N 142.59

5 Your arrows are sharp in the heart of the King’s enemies; The peoples fall under You. 365N 142.60

6 Your throne, O God, is forever and ever; A scepter of righteousness is the scepter of Your kingdom. 365N 142.61

7 You love righteousness and hate wickedness; Therefore God, Your God, has anointed You With the oil of gladness more than Your companions. 365N 142.62

8 All Your garments are scented with myrrh and aloes and cassia, Out of the ivory palaces, by which they have made You glad. 365N 142.63

9 Kings’ daughters are among Your honorable women; At Your right hand stands the queen in gold from Ophir. 365N 142.64

10 Listen, O daughter, Consider and incline your ear; Forget your own people also, and your father’s house; 365N 142.65

11 So the King will greatly desire your beauty; Because He is your Lord, worship Him. 365N 142.66

12 And the daughter of Tyre will come with a gift; The rich among the people will seek your favor. 365N 142.67

13 The royal daughter is all glorious within the palace; Her clothing is woven with gold. 365N 142.68

14 She shall be brought to the King in robes of many colors; The virgins, her companions who follow her, shall be brought to You. 365N 142.69

15 With gladness and rejoicing they shall be brought; They shall enter the King’s palace. 365N 142.70

16 Instead of Your fathers shall be Your sons, Whom You shall make princes in all the earth. 365N 142.71

17 I will make Your name to be remembered in all generations; Therefore the people shall praise You forever and ever. 365N 142.72
